1977 Ford Cortina vs. 1983 Renault 11
To start off, 1983 Renault 11 is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1977 Ford Cortina.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1977 Ford Cortina would be higher. At 4,093 cc (6 cylinders), 1977 Ford Cortina is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1977 Ford Cortina (123 HP @ 3700 RPM) has 42 more horse power than 1983 Renault 11. (81 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1977 Ford Cortina should accelerate faster than 1983 Renault 11.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1977 Ford Cortina weights approximately 245 kg more than 1983 Renault 11.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1977 Ford Cortina (289 Nm @ 2400 RPM) has 150 more torque (in Nm) than 1983 Renault 11. (139 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1977 Ford Cortina will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1983 Renault 11.
